
Ronaldo Shines as Portugal Edges Spain in Nations League Thriller
So, the big question everyone’s buzzing about: who won, Portugal or Spain? Well, it was Portugal who came out on top in a dramatic Nations League final that had it all — goals, tension, and even tears from Cristiano Ronaldo himself. This victory was special, marking Ronaldo’s third UEFA trophy with his national team, and a memorable moment for the 40-year-old superstar who continues to defy age and expectations.
Even though Ronaldo was substituted late in the game, by the 88th minute, he had already made a crucial impact. In the 61st minute, he scored a spectacular close-range goal to bring the score to 2-2, his 138th international goal — a record that keeps extending. His performance throughout the tournament has been outstanding, scoring eight goals in nine Nations League games, proving that even after moving to the Saudi league, his hunger and skill remain unmatched.

Portugal’s win is even more impressive considering Spain’s dominance in recent years. Spain had been riding high, winning the Nations League in 2023 and the Euro 2024, but Portugal disrupted that streak. One of the most fascinating storylines was the clash between Ronaldo and Spain’s teenage prodigy, Lamine Yamal. While Yamal dazzled in previous matches, especially against France in the semis, he struggled against Portugal’s defense, particularly against Nuno Mendes.
Mendes was named man of the match, shutting down Yamal effectively and even scoring a goal himself. His energy, defensive solidity, and attacking flair played a huge part in Portugal’s success, making him a standout star alongside Ronaldo. Many pundits and fans alike were impressed by Mendes’ all-around performance, calling him a complete defender and a joy to watch.
Fans and commentators alike celebrated Ronaldo’s relentless spirit. Even at 40, he continues to prove why he’s one of football’s greatest, with pundits saying he still knows exactly where to be and how to make the difference. His emotional reaction after lifting the trophy showed just how much this win meant to him personally.
